
Uestions What is the Title VII Program? The Orange Unified School District was awarded the Title VII-Native American Education Federal Grant in 1975. The Grant supports the academic and cultural needs of Native American Students in the district. Who qualifies for this program? All students who are ancestors of the original American Indian Tribes of the United States. Do I need to be Tribally Enrolled? How to fill out the OMB 1810 0021 Form online
The OMB 1810 0021 Form is essential for certifying student eligibility under the Indian Education Program. This guide will provide you with detailed, step-by-step instructions on filling out the form online, ensuring a smooth process.
Follow the steps to complete the form accurately and efficiently.
- Click the ‘Get Form’ button to access the form and open it in your preferred online editor.
- Begin filling in the 'Name of Child' section by entering the full name as it appears on the school enrollment records.
- Next, input the 'Date of Birth' of the child, ensuring the accuracy of the date format.
- Fill in the 'School Name' where the child is enrolled.
- Indicate the child's current 'Grade' in school by selecting the appropriate option from the dropdown, if applicable.
- Complete the section regarding 'Name of Tribe, Band or Group' by providing the exact name as recognized.
- In the box under 'Tribe, Band or Group is: (check one)', select the applicable classification that fits the child’s affiliation.
- Provide the 'Name of individual with tribal membership', identifying if this is the child, parent, or grandparent.
- Next, indicate the 'Proof of membership' by entering either the membership or enrollment number or providing an explanation if necessary.
- Complete the section detailing the 'Name and address of organization maintaining membership data'. This information is crucial for verification.
- Ensure to sign the form in the 'Parent's Signature' section and provide the 'Date' of signature.
- Finally, enter your mailing address and telephone number. You may also provide an email address for further correspondence.
- After completing the form, review it for accuracy. Save your changes, download a copy for your records, print the form for submission, or share it with the necessary parties.

What is the Title VI ED 506 Indian Student Eligibility Cert Form?
The Title VI ED 506 form is used to establish eligibility for Indian students in federally funded educational programs. This form ensures that eligible Native American students receive the necessary support and services. What are 506 students?
The 506 form is a federal form that certifies student eligibility for the Title VI, Indian Education Program. You can download and print the form below or you can get one from your child's school Records Department.
What is Title VI Indian Education Formula Grant Program?
The Indian Education Formula Grant program provides grants to support local educational agencies in their efforts to reform elementary and secondary school programs that serve Indian students. Annually each applicant develops and submits to the Department a comprehensive plan for meeting the needs of Indian children.
